Understanding the Current Fantasy Football Landscape

The fantasy football tips UK focus update for this season emphasises the importance of early research and strategic planning. The Premier League fantasy format remains popular, but understanding how scoring systems work is crucial. Points are awarded for appearances, goals, assists, clean sheets, and bonus points, making player selection a nuanced process that goes beyond simply choosing the most expensive players.

Current trends show that mid-priced players often provide better value than premium assets. Many successful managers focus on identifying emerging talent and players in form rather than relying solely on established stars. Building Your Squad: Selection Strategies

Creating a balanced squad requires understanding positional requirements and budget allocation. The fantasy football tips UK focus update recommends starting with a clear structure: typically three premium defenders, a mix of mid-range midfielders, and flexible forward options. This approach provides flexibility for transfers while maintaining competitive coverage across all positions.

Player form analysis is essential when building your squad. Look beyond last season’s statistics and focus on current performance, injury status, and playing time. The fantasy football tips UK focus update emphasises that consistency matters more than occasional high-scoring performances. Defenders from well-organised teams often provide steady point accumulation through clean sheets and bonus points.

  • Research team fixtures for the next five gameweeks before making transfers
  • Monitor injury reports and team news religiously throughout the week
  • Consider bench strength to cover for injured players without using transfers
  • Balance premium players with budget options to maximise squad depth
  • Track player ownership percentages to identify differential opportunities

Transfer Strategy and Gameweek Planning

Effective transfer management separates successful fantasy managers from casual players. The fantasy football tips UK focus update stresses that transfers should be purposeful rather than reactive. Plan your transfers based on upcoming fixtures, injury news, and form trends rather than making impulsive changes after poor gameweeks.

Captaincy selection represents one of the most important decisions in fantasy football. The fantasy football tips UK focus update recommends captaining players with favourable fixtures, strong recent form, and high ownership. Occasionally, differential captain choices can yield significant advantages if you correctly identify an underrated player facing a weak defence.

Bench management often determines final league positions. Ensure your substitutes can cover for injured players and provide flexibility for tactical adjustments. The fantasy football tips UK focus update highlights how proper bench planning reduces the need for emergency transfers, preserving your transfer budget for strategic upgrades.

Advanced Tactical Considerations

Successful fantasy managers employ advanced tactics beyond basic player selection. The fantasy football tips UK focus update discusses how understanding team formations and playing styles influences player performance. Teams using attacking formations typically generate more chances, benefiting attacking players, while defensive-minded teams produce more clean sheets.

Fixture difficulty ratings provide valuable guidance for planning your season. The fantasy football tips UK focus update recommends identifying periods when your squad faces favourable matchups and planning transfers to capitalise on these opportunities. Conversely, anticipate challenging fixture periods and consider defensive transfers to minimise damage.

Chip usage strategy deserves careful consideration throughout the season. The fantasy football tips UK focus update suggests using your free hit chip during gameweeks with widespread injuries or unusual circumstances. The triple captain chip works best during double gameweeks when selected players have two matches, potentially doubling their point accumulation.
